If there's a better looking truck than these new Dodge 2500's then I sure haven't seen it. Nice ride.

As for the new Durango, I think it's a step in the wrong direction. It looks too much like a car to me. I like the Durango's truck like appearance. I think this new one looks too much like a station wagon with a big engine and four wheel drive. The same goes for the new Ford Explorer too. If I wanted a crossover SUV I'd buy one of the ones that are already on the market, including those offered by Ford and Chrysler. My wife has a Honda CRV and I like it a lot, but it's nothing more than a car with AWD. If I wanted an SUV I'd want one built on a truck platform, and there are precious few options in that arena nowadays. It looks like if you want a real truck based SUV then you have to buy a full size SUV like a Tahoe, Suburban or Expedition. I guess that shouldn't be too much of a surprise though since the automakers also seem to be abandoning the small pickup truck segment too. It'll be a shame to see the truck based Durango go. I'm not much of a Chrysler guy in general but I've put more miles behind the wheel of my take home Durango from work in the past 2 years than both my wife and I have put on our personal vehicles combined. It is the best quality Chrysler product I've driven and my mother has owned several Chrysler products and my Uncle still owns a CTD powered Ram. My Durango has needed nothing besides brakes, but that's not unusual as it's a police car and is driven hard and fast sometimes.
